Why Sandsfield Park?

With green spaces perfect for wonderful walks, but yet close to an abundance of amenities, schools and transport links, it is easy to see why this area is a popular choice. It is on a regular bus route and is only a fifteen minute walk to the Cumberland Infirmary. Close to the historic City of Carlisle and has easy access to the city bypass and the M6 motorway. The stunning Lake District is about 30 minutes drive away.

Here are the top 7 things you need to know when moving home:

Get your house valued by 3 different agents before you put it on the market

Don't pick the agent that values it the highest, without evidence of other properties sold in the same area

It's always best to put your house on the market before you find a property

The estate agent acts for the seller and is there to get the seller the best price possible

Understand the length of time it can take - 14 weeks from when you accept an offer, or have an offer accepted to move in! A long time!

It can get stressful, but speak to your agent and your solicitor and they will put you in the picture

Be nice to estate agents - we're pretty nice people, offer some great advice and will help to get you moved ;-)
